Technical Specifications
| Parameter | Value |
|---|---|
| Designation | INA NKI35/30-XL |
| Bearing Type | Needle Roller Bearing with Inner Ring |
| Bore Diameter (d) | 35 mm |
| Outside Diameter (D) | 50 mm |
| Width (B) | 30 mm |
| Weight | 0.2 kg |
| Material | Bearing Steel |
| Seal or Shield Type | Open |
| Number of Rows | Single Row |
| Arrangement | Radial Bearing |
| Origin | Manufacturer production facilities |

Matching the Radial Envelope Constraint in Small Gearboxes
The INA NKI35/30-XL needle roller bearing occupies a 35×50×30 mm envelope, which is typical for auxiliary shafts in compact industrial reducers where every millimeter of cross-section is contested between bearing capacity and housing wall thickness. Needle rollers carry high radial loads relative to their section height, making them the default choice when designers cannot afford the radial depth of a ball or spherical roller bearing. Open-type construction allows direct oil-bath or splash lubrication from the gearbox sump, eliminating the need for separate grease channels that add machining cost to small housings. When we cross-reference this designation against equivalent models from other brands, we align bore diameter, outside diameter, width, cage type, and surface treatment together — never just the numeric base.
Load Spectra and Thermal Conditions Inside Gearbox Housings
Gearbox internal shafts see predominantly radial loading with moderate shock from gear mesh impacts and frequent directional reversals during start-stop cycles. Operating temperatures typically climb above ambient once the oil sump reaches equilibrium, meaning thermal expansion of the shaft and housing must be accounted for during fit selection. An open-type bearing like this one depends on the gearbox's own filtration and oil-change intervals to keep contaminants out of the rolling contact zone. [NEED_CITE: needle roller bearing lubrication interval guidelines for enclosed gear drives] The 35 mm bore means shaft fits are generally on the tighter side of the tolerance band, and pressing an inner ring onto a shaft without controlled induction heating can score the raceway before the gearbox ever turns over.
Reading the Core Specifications That Matter
The inner ring included with the INA NKI35/30-XL needle roller bearing allows installation on hardened-and-ground shafts where the shaft surface itself is not prepared to serve as a roller raceway — a common requirement in repair scenarios where replacing the entire shaft is uneconomical. Bearing steel construction provides the standard hardness and fatigue resistance needed for the Hertzian contact stress that needle rollers generate along their line contact with the raceway. Open-type design trades contamination protection for zero seal friction, which matters in small gearboxes where seal drag can represent a measurable share of total power loss. The single-row arrangement keeps axial guidance simple, but it also means any axial load must be handled by a separate locating bearing elsewhere on the shaft.
The Hidden Price of an Incorrect Needle Roller Selection
Installing a needle roller bearing that matches bore and OD but uses a standard cage and untreated rollers in an application that demands X-life surface conditioning will produce spalling on the inner ring raceway within a fraction of the calculated L10 life. [NEED_CITE: ISO 281 basic rating life framework for rolling bearings] Metal particles from early spalling circulate through the gearbox oil and attack meshing gear flanks, turning a bearing replacement into a full gearbox rebuild. Counterfeit needle rollers with soft cores and cloned outer markings are entering industrial supply chains through unverified intermediaries, and they pass casual visual inspection because the packaging and laser etching are convincing. Downtime on a production gearbox is measured in lost output per hour, not in the unit cost of the bearing sitting in the storeroom.

Storage, Handling & Mounting
- Keep each INA NKI35/30-XL needle roller bearing in its original sealed export packaging until the moment of installation; the 35 mm bore inner ring raceway is exposed on the open-type design and will collect dust or moisture if stored unpackaged in a workshop environment.
- Maintain storage area humidity below 60 percent to protect the bearing steel surfaces and the factory-applied corrosion preventive, especially in tropical or coastal warehouse locations common among our Middle East and Southeast Asia customers.
- Use clean, lint-free gloves when handling the single-row needle roller cage assembly; finger acids on bare skin can initiate micro-corrosion pits on the rollers that propagate into spalling under cyclic load.
- For shaft mounting, apply controlled induction heating to the inner ring rather than mechanical pressing alone — the 35 mm bore and 30 mm width create enough press-fit interference that brute-force installation risks brinelling the needle rollers against the outer raceway.
- After installation in an open-type gearbox application, confirm that the housing lubrication system delivers adequate oil flow to the bearing zone; the INA NKI35/30-XL needle roller bearing relies entirely on the gearbox sump or splash system since it carries no integral seals or pre-packed grease.

Q: What should I check when cross-referencing this needle roller bearing to another brand? A: Match bore diameter (35 mm), outside diameter (50 mm), and width (30 mm) first, then confirm cage material, roller surface treatment, and whether the substitute includes an inner ring. A base-number-only match that ignores these factors is the most common cause of premature cage failure in cross-referenced needle roller applications.
Q: Should I choose an open or sealed needle roller bearing for a gearbox application? A: Enclosed gearboxes with an oil-bath or splash lubrication system typically use open-type bearings like this designation because the gearbox oil provides both lubrication and cooling without the friction penalty of contact seals. Sealed variants are reserved for applications where external contamination cannot be controlled by the housing design.
Q: What are the re-lubrication requirements for this open-type needle roller bearing? A: Open-type needle roller bearings in enclosed gearboxes rely on the gearbox oil itself, so re-lubrication intervals align with the gearbox manufacturer's oil-change schedule rather than a separate bearing greasing cycle. Always confirm that the oil level and filtration rating meet the bearing manufacturer's recommendations for needle roller contact zones.
